Abstract

This Regional Decree validates regulations on regional ethno-natural parks, nature monuments, forest genetic reserves and natural heritage monuments. Ethno-natural parks shall be considered protected natural areas of regional significance, having a special environmental, scientific, cultural, aesthetic, recreational and healthcare value created with the aim of preserving natural complex sites, spiritual and material culture of local population and intended for environmental, historical and cultural education of the people and tourism. Nature monuments shall be considered protected natural areas of regional significance, within the borders of which there are unique natural complexes and objects, including separate natural objects (single trees, groves, forests, rivers, swamps, springs, islands, geological sections, caverns, cult natural sites, places of sacrifice), which are of scientific, cultural and aesthetic value. Forest genetic reserves shall be considered protected natural areas of regional significance consisting of areas of natural forests or forest plantations, unique or typical by their phytocenotic, silvicultural and forest growth indicators for a given natural and climatic region, on which the valuable in genetic and selection relation part of populations of forest species. Natural heritage monuments shall be considered protected natural areas of regional significance with unique natural formations of various historical epochs and periods, of great scientific interest, as well as natural areas (localities) associated with historical events and personalities.
